Exploring the Artistic Mastery of Woman Cleaning Turnips by Jean-Baptiste-Simeon Chardin

Historical Context of 18th Century French Art

The Role of Still Life in Chardin's Work

Jean-Baptiste-Simeon Chardin emerged as a pivotal figure in 18th century French art, particularly known for his still life paintings. During this period, still life became a significant genre, allowing artists to explore themes of domesticity and the beauty of everyday objects. Chardin's work, including "Woman Cleaning Turnips," exemplifies this trend, showcasing the intricate relationship between art and the mundane aspects of life.

Influence of the Rococo Movement on Chardin's Style

The Rococo movement, characterized by its ornate details and playful themes, influenced many artists of Chardin's time. However, Chardin took a different approach. He focused on simplicity and realism, contrasting the frivolity of Rococo with a grounded perspective. His paintings often reflect a serene beauty, emphasizing the dignity of labor and the importance of domestic life.

Symbolism of Turnips: Nourishment and Domesticity

Turnips in this painting symbolize nourishment and the essence of domestic life. They represent the sustenance that families rely on, highlighting the importance of food preparation in daily routines. This focus on humble vegetables elevates the ordinary to the extraordinary, showcasing Chardin's ability to find beauty in simplicity.

Light and Shadow: Chardin's Mastery of Chiaroscuro

Chardin's skillful use of chiaroscuro, the contrast between light and shadow, adds depth and dimension to "Woman Cleaning Turnips." The soft light illuminates the figure and the turnips, creating a three-dimensional effect that enhances the realism of the scene. This technique draws attention to the textures of the woman's clothing and the surfaces of the vegetables, making the painting come alive.

Chardin's Unique Approach to Everyday Life

Depiction of Women in Domestic Roles: A Feminine Perspective

In "Woman Cleaning Turnips," Chardin presents a powerful depiction of women in domestic roles. The woman is portrayed with dignity and grace, reflecting the essential contributions of women to household life. This focus on female labor offers a unique perspective, celebrating the often-overlooked work that sustains families and communities.

Realism vs. Idealism: The Authenticity of Chardin's Subjects

Chardin's approach to realism sets him apart from many of his contemporaries. He eschews idealized forms in favor of authentic representations of his subjects. In "Woman Cleaning Turnips," the woman is not an archetype of beauty but a relatable figure engaged in a common task. This authenticity resonates with viewers, inviting them to connect with the painting on a personal level.

Contrasting Techniques with Contemporary Artists

While many contemporary artists embraced abstraction and idealism, Chardin remained committed to realism. His techniques, such as the careful observation of light and texture, contrast sharply with the more experimental approaches of his peers. This dedication to realism allows Chardin's work to stand out, offering a refreshing perspective in the art world.

The Legacy of Jean-Baptiste-Simeon Chardin

Impact on Future Generations of Artists

Chardin's influence extends far beyond his lifetime. His dedication to realism and the portrayal of everyday life inspired countless artists in the generations that followed. His ability to elevate the mundane into art has left a lasting mark on the art world, encouraging artists to find beauty in their surroundings.

Chardin's Influence on Modern Still Life and Genre Painting

Today, Chardin's legacy is evident in modern still life and genre painting. Artists continue to draw inspiration from his techniques and themes, exploring the intersection of art and daily life. "Woman Cleaning Turnips" remains a testament to Chardin's enduring impact, reminding us of the beauty found in simplicity.
